Production of industrial output and energy, March 2013
According to Statistics Estonia, in March 2013, the production of industrial enterprises increased by 7% compared to March of the previous year. The growth in the production was most of all influenced by the manufacturing of electronic products and electricity.

PHC 2011: population by religious affiliation, 31 December 2011
According to the data of the 2011 Population and Housing Census (PHC 2011), 320,872 persons or 29% of Estonian population aged 15 and older are affiliated with a particular religion. This percentage has not changed compared to the previous, 2000 Census.

PHC 2011: population by marital status, 31 December 2011
According to the data of the 2011 Population and Housing Census (PHC 2011), the share of persons living in a consensual union has increased significantly and the share of people living with a legal spouse has decreased compared to the previous, 2000 Census.

Foreign trade, February 2013
According to Statistics Estonia, in February 2013, exports of goods declined by 2% and imports by 3% at current prices, compared to February of the previous year. The fall in exports and imports was influenced by the significant decrease in trade with mineral fuels.
